Well weather here in North Scotland improving a tad so decided to take the plunge and start the repairs and clean up of my 2001 Blazer
This is going to include the following (at least I know of !!!!) :-
Refurbish ALL brake calipers.
Replace ALL metal brake lines.
Replace rubber brake flex's with Stainless braided.
Refurbish brake components and new pads all round and new parking brake shoes.
New bottom ball joints..top good.
New anti roll bar bushes.
N/S rear axle has a small amount of lateral play so need to get into rear axle and check...replacing oils when there.
After I check front steering components might have a bit of replacement there !!
Looking to replace the rear shackles and go for a bit lift at the same time..
Work on front arms to lift to align with rear above.....
New front and rear shocks.
Once thats finished I will then look at new rubber for the wheels...can go for more off rader pattern with lift planned
Full wire brush etc and repaint / underseal underside including axles and chassis etc
So far with decent weather today removed all front rear brake components and front suspension arms etc ........
